技术文摘
Linux下多个mysql5.7.19(tar.gz)安装图文教程深度解析
Linux下多个mysql5.7.19(tar.gz)安装图文教程深度解析
在Linux环境中,有时需要安装多个mysql5.7.19实例以满足不同的业务需求。下面为大家详细介绍其安装过程。
首先是准备工作。确保你已经从官方网站下载好了mysql5.7.19的tar.gz安装包,并上传到Linux服务器指定目录。要确保服务器有足够的磁盘空间和相应的权限。
解压安装包。登录到Linux服务器,使用命令“tar -zxvf mysql-5.7.19-linux-glibc2.12-x86_64.tar.gz”解压安装包,解压后会得到一个文件夹。可以将其重命名为便于识别的名称,如“mysql5719”。
创建用户和用户组。为了安全和规范管理,创建专门的mysql用户和用户组,使用命令“groupadd mysql”创建用户组,“useradd -r -g mysql mysql”创建用户,这里“-r”表示创建系统用户,“-g”指定所属用户组。
配置环境变量。打开“/etc/profile”文件,在文件末尾添加“export PATH=/path/to/mysql5719/bin:$PATH”,其中“/path/to/mysql5719”替换为实际的mysql解压目录路径。保存文件后,执行“source /etc/profile”使配置生效。
初始化数据库。进入mysql的bin目录,执行“mysqld --initialize --user=mysql --basedir=/path/to/mysql5719 --datadir=/path/to/data”,这里“/path/to/data”是指定的数据存储目录,需要提前创建并赋予mysql用户读写权限。初始化完成后,会生成一个临时密码。
启动mysql服务。使用命令“mysqld_safe --user=mysql &”启动服务,“&”表示在后台运行。
修改密码。使用临时密码登录mysql,“mysql -uroot -p”,然后执行“ALTER USER 'root'@'localhost' IDENTIFIED BY 'newpassword';”修改密码,“newpassword”替换为你设置的新密码。
重复上述步骤,就可以在Linux下安装多个mysql5.7.19实例。在安装过程中,每个实例的端口、数据存储目录等关键配置要确保不冲突,可通过修改配置文件来实现。
通过以上详细的图文教程深度解析,相信大家能够顺利在Linux环境中安装多个mysql5.7.19实例,满足多样化的业务场景需求。
TAGS: Linux安装教程 MySQL5.7.19安装 tar.gz安装 图文教程解析